Estoy tratando de usar OpenDNS en mi teléfono. He intentado usar SetDNS , DNS Changer y DNSet . Al menos dos de ellos afirman permitir cambiar el DNS wifi sin acceso de root (solo estoy usando wifi en un S3 mini no rooteado con 4.1.2). No importa lo que haga, las páginas de prueba de OpenDNS dicen que no funciona, y también instalé una aplicación llamada Ping & DNS que puede mostrar la información de mi red e indica que mi DNS siempre se obtiene de cualquier enrutador al que esté conectado, independientemente de cualquier aplicación de DNS que tenga en ejecución.
En realidad, si tengo SetDNS y DNSet ejecutándose al mismo tiempo, entonces SetDNS afirma estar usando el DNS de Google (8.8.8.8, DNSet solo es compatible con el DNS de Google). Pero Ping & DNS todavía dice que solo estoy obteniendo la configuración de DNS del enrutador. No estoy seguro de cuál es realmente en ese momento. Independientemente, quiero usar OpenDNS.
ACTUALIZACIÓN: para ser claros, estoy usando estas aplicaciones de cambio de DNS porque quiero que todas las conexiones se realicen automáticamente y solo usen OpenDNS. Entonces, quiero saber por qué ninguna de estas aplicaciones funciona como se anuncia (cuando los revisores no dicen que no funcionan), o cómo puedo hacer que funcione para todas las conexiones sin una aplicación de tal manera que no pueda ser alterado sin una contraseña o algo así. Y realmente no quiero molestarme en rootear si no es necesario.
El sitio web de OpenDNS tiene su propio conjunto de instrucciones para usar sus servicios en dispositivos Android, proporcioné sus instrucciones a continuación:
Settings
Wi-Fi
Modify Network
Advanced Options
IP Settings
, haga clic DHCP
y cámbiela aStatic
Primero habilite la depuración USB. Puede usar adb y usar el comando root
o su shell
y copiar el build.prop
archivo en /storage/sdcard/0/
o /storage/exsdcard
con el copy /system/build.prop /storage/sdcard/0/
comando (la ruta de almacenamiento de su (ex) tarjeta SD varía de un dispositivo a otro). En este archivo se guarda la IP del servidor DNS. Encuéntralo y cámbialo a la IP de OpenDNS. Ahora cópielo de nuevo a su /system/
carpeta con copy /storage/sdcard/0/build.prop /system/
. Reinicie su teléfono y debería funcionar.
dantis
Max Chinni